What Is the HPE2-W11 Exam All About?
The HPE2-W11 Selling HPE Aruba Networking Solutions exam measures a candidate’s ability to prospect, qualify, and propose HPE Aruba Networking solutions. Its primary goal is to ensure candidates possess the expertise to solve customer challenges by aligning their needs with HPE Aruba’s comprehensive portfolio. Let’s dive into the key details and objectives of this exam to understand its scope.
Why Take the HPE2-W11 Exam?
Professionals who pass this exam demonstrate mastery in key areas, such as understanding customer business objectives, competitive differentiation, and positioning HPE Aruba Networking solutions effectively. Roles that benefit from this certification include:
Account Executives
Field Sales Representatives
Inside Sales Representatives
Sales Support Personnel
Key Exam Objectives
The HPE2-W11 exam focuses on seven core objectives, which are integral to understanding and selling HPE Aruba Networking solutions. Here’s a closer look:
1. Trends and Market Context (5%)
Recognize the evolving trends influencing customer buying decisions at the edge.
Address customer concerns by analyzing relevant market initiatives.
2. Customer Business Objectives (8%)
Engage in insightful customer conversations to uncover their objectives.
Identify and align with customer personas to address specific challenges at the edge.
3. HPE Aruba Networking Strategy/Where to Play (17%)
Understand and articulate HPE Aruba Networking’s core strategy.
Map solutions to customer needs and business outcomes effectively.
4. Competitive and Winning Strategy (17%)
Compare HPE Aruba’s offerings with competitors to highlight its unique value proposition.
Emphasize key differentiators that make HPE Aruba stand out in the marketplace.
5. HPE Aruba Networking Value Proposition (12%)
Deep dive into the HPE Aruba ESP portfolio, detailing its features and benefits.
Showcase how HPE’s solutions help businesses succeed in a connected world.
6. Selling Solutions (23%)
This is the largest and most critical segment of the exam, covering areas such as:
Unified Infrastructure portfolio solutions
AIOps portfolio solutions
Zero Trust solutions
Demonstrating how these technologies resolve connectivity and security challenges for customers.
7. Services, Support, and Consumption Trends (18%)
Explain modern IT consumption models and their benefits for customers.
Highlight HPE Aruba’s range of flexible consumption services, such as Connectivity-as-a-Service, and articulate their business value.

Top DevOps Trends to Watch in 2025
80% of businesses have adopted the DevOps approach.
DevOps has completely transformed software development and IT operations- improving efficiency, collaboration, and automation. The market has witnessed a tremendous evolution in DevOps due to the latest trends and technological advancements, expected to increase its market by 25% from 2024 to 2032.

The emergence of technologies like AI and ML is driving the growth, resulting in improved predictive analytics, automated testing, and advanced monitoring. In addition, the alignment of DevOps with cloud and microservices architecture has brought prominent benefits for businesses in terms of scalability, resiliency, and speedy innovations. From advanced security to real-time monitoring, many trends have been driving the DevOps landscape for overall business success and performance.
Staying ahead of the competition, and understanding the latest DevOps trends is important. Let’s uncover the top DevOps trends crucial for any business success in 2025. 
7 DevOps Trends

DevOps trends are all about data that businesses might explore more in 2025. With AI/ML integrations, businesses can benefit from real-time data, optimizing resource allocation, predicting potential threats, and improving development operations. 
1. Generative AI Adoption in AIOps
Generative AI is all about simplifying operations by automation and improving developer’s experience. Implementing GenAI in AIOps has transformed how businesses manage their IT operations.

Businesses can leverage AI to automate tasks, identify potential issues, and even fix them without any human intervention- saving time and reducing human errors. It helps make IT operations smarter and more efficient, leading to more productive and faster time-to-market results. 
Brands like Netflix, Google, and IBM are using GenAI to optimize their workflows, including predictive maintenance in data centers, and automated software testing respectively, ultimately accelerating development cycles and improving operational efficiency.  
2. DevSecOps- Improving Security Posture
It is one of the key trends of DevOps, considering 2025 and beyond. Businesses are more aware of improving their business's security postures and integrating solutions at early CI/CD stages. It helps in identifying and mitigating high-risk issues. 
It is based on a “shift-left” approach, where security issues are detected and fixed at early stages, leading to more secure apps.

Businesses can automate and monitor security throughout SDLC, promoting a proactive and collaborative approach to security. About 37% of businesses adopt the DevSecOps approach for the secure app development process. The DevSecOps approach includes-
Providing security training to software developers and DevOps personnel
Creating central policies for security integration
Helping teams with cloud security training and certifications
3. The rise of Serverless Architecture 
DevOps teams might increase their adoption of serverless architecture to simplify app development and management processes. In traditional setups, businesses managed and maintained their servers. But with serverless, developers can create code using GenAI tools within seconds and their cloud providers will manage all their code deployments.
Some popular services are Google Cloud Functions, AWS Lambda, and Azure Functions have optimized resource allocation and improved cost efficiency. It reduces the complexity of managing infrastructure and allows development teams to deliver features faster, with less overhead.
4. Introduction of MLOps in DevOps

MLOps aims to overcome challenges with ML projects, including building, deploying, and managing ML models in production. MLOps applies the same principles as DevOps to machine learning projects. It helps teams to collaborate, automate workflows, and ensure that models are deployed and maintained efficiently.
MLOps ensures that the model is tested, updated, and deployed to production quickly and reliably. It automates tasks like training the model, testing its accuracy, and rolling out updates without causing disruptions. This allows businesses to continuously improve their ML models and deliver more accurate predictions while maintaining a smooth, automated pipeline. 
5. Automating DevOps Using NoOps and NewOps
This approach minimizes the operational requirements by automating the workflow, without any human intervention to monitor the tasks. NoOps is a way of doing this, where IT tasks are fully automated and the need to manage servers and infrastructure manually is removed.

In NoOps, things like setting up infrastructure and deploying applications are handled automatically through cloud services, without much human intervention. Big companies like Google, Facebook, and AWS use this approach to scale and run their systems because it’s impossible to manage everything manually at such a large scale. So, NoOps doesn’t mean there are no IT operations, but it’s about doing things automatically rather than manually.
However, NoOps is only relevant for a homogeneous IT environment, with minimal changes at the infrastructure level. Thus, a shift to NewOps is required to address the shifting landscape of modern IT operations, making it suitable to handle heterogeneous IT environment with several change and handoffs.

6. DevEdgeOps Pltaforms

DevOps for Edge Computing is about applying automation, collaboration, and continuous delivery to manage applications and systems at the edge of the network. In simple words, closer to where the data is generated. In traditional computing, data is processed in large data centers far away. But with edge computing, data is processed locally, allowing for faster decision-making and lower latency.
In DevOps for Edge Computing, teams use automation to deploy, monitor, and update software directly on edge devices, which can be harder to manage than centralized systems. 
As the need for edge computing increases, organizations are looking for solutions that simplify the development and management of applications in edge environments. This has led to the rise of DevEdgeOps platforms, which offer tools and processes specifically designed to meet the unique challenges of building, deploying, and running applications in edge computing setups.
7. Green DevOps for Sustainability 
Green DevOps is all about implementing DevOps practices with a focus on sustainability. It involves designing and implementing a DevOps approach to reduce the environmental impact of the CI/CD pipeline. These continuous processes consume a lot of resources and impact carbon footprint.
Businesses can implement sustainable practices to contribute to sustainable deployments. Brands like Netflix, Google, and Microsoft have adopted Green DevOps operations.
Netflix uses automation and containers to reduce resource use when deploying software.
Google focuses on energy efficiency and sustainability in its data centers. It uses cooling technologies, renewable energy, and efficient hardware to reduce resource consumption.
Microsoft provides tools like Azure DevOps and GitHub Actions to help users build sustainable applications.

Artificial Intelligence (AI) denotes the concept and development of computing systems capable of performing tasks customarily requiring human assistance, such as decision-making, speech recognition, visual perception, and language translation. AI uses algorithms to understand human speech, visually recognize objects, and process information. These algorithms are used for data processing, calculation, and automated reasoning. Artificial intelligence researchers continuously improve algorithms for various aspects, as conventional algorithms have drawbacks regarding accuracy and efficiency.
These advancements have led manufacturers and technology developers to focus on developing standard algorithms. Recently, several developments have been carried out for enhancing artificial intelligence algorithms. For instance, in May 2020, International Business Machines Corporation announced a wide range of new AI-powered services and capabilities, namely IBM Watson AIOps, for enterprise automation. These services are designed to help automate the IT infrastructures and make them more resilient and cost reduction.

1. Introduction to Web Content Filtering
What is Web Content Filtering?
Web content filtering is a crucial aspect of internet security, involving the control of what content is accessible over the internet within a particular network. It helps organizations prevent access to harmful or inappropriate websites, thus safeguarding employees and data.
Importance of Web Content Filtering
The importance of web content filtering cannot be overstated. It helps protect against malware, phishing attacks, and other cyber threats. Additionally, it ensures compliance with legal and regulatory standards, improves productivity by blocking distracting websites, and maintains a company's reputation by preventing access to inappropriate content.

5. Introduction to AIOps Platforms
What are AIOps Platforms?
AIOps platforms use artificial intelligence to enhance IT operations. They analyze large volumes of data from various IT operations tools and devices to automatically identify and resolve IT issues. This helps improve the efficiency and reliability of IT operations.
Importance of AIOps Platforms
AIOps platforms are essential for modern IT operations due to their ability to handle the complexity and scale of today's IT environments. They help reduce downtime, improve performance, and enhance the overall user experience.

The Rise of AIOps Platforms
Traditional IT operations management often involves manual processes, reactive issue resolution, and siloed data analysis. This approach can lead to inefficiencies, delays in problem resolution, and missed opportunities for proactive management. AIOps platforms, powered by AI and machine learning (ML), bring a paradigm shift by automating and enhancing various aspects of IT operations:
Automated Monitoring and Analysis: AIOps platforms aggregate and analyze vast amounts of data from disparate sources in real-time. By leveraging ML algorithms, these platforms can detect anomalies, identify patterns, and predict potential issues before they impact operations.
Root Cause Analysis: One of the significant challenges in IT operations is identifying the root cause of problems amidst complex and interconnected systems. AIOps platforms use advanced analytics to trace issues back to their origin, facilitating quicker resolution and minimizing downtime.
Predictive Insights: By analyzing historical data and real-time metrics, AIOps platforms can provide predictive insights into future performance trends and potential bottlenecks. This proactive approach enables IT teams to preemptively address issues and optimize resource allocation.
Automation of Routine Tasks: Routine IT tasks such as system monitoring, log management, and incident response can be automated through AI-driven workflows. This automation not only reduces manual effort but also frees up IT personnel to focus on more strategic initiatives.

Key Trends of Next-Gen AIOps to Dominate 2024

Artificial Intelligence for Operations (AIOps) puts machine learning, big data, NLP, and other AI technologies to the task of streamlining IT processes and automating IT functionalities. As data becomes the new oil, AIOps is quickly growing as the vital organ of IT businesses across the globe. 
Automation, prediction, and analytics are some of the capabilities that the IT sector is ingesting due to the effective implementation of AIOps. Unlike traditional IT operations, IT infrastructure, networks, and applications leverage machine learning algorithms, correlation engines, and advanced analytical tools.
AIOps trends in 2024 will transform IT operations, enhance performance, and increase productivity amidst concerns about AI saturation. 
Increased Adoption of AIOps: 
Just over 50% of IT companies have drawn up plans to implement AIOps in their businesses, given their widespread and lasting benefits. AI and automation solutions have been witnessing rapid growth as businesses are looking to cut costs amid global supply chain disruptions. 
The cloud-native data explosion has made it difficult for humans to manage data. AIOps effectively aggregates, compartmentalizes, and analyzes data in huge volumes.
Traditional tracking tools have become defunct as AI development companies leverage machine learning to monitor intelligently.
IT companies witness financial constraints due to performance issues. AI solutions identify glitches quickly and automate remedies before the user gets affected.
Longer uptime and reliability can easily result in financial losses. AIOps solutions provide that flexibility and troubleshooting beforehand.
Skill scarcity has been a major issue in the IT sector. Comparatively, AI-powered solutions can perform IT operations 24*7 without asking for monthly pay.
Cost efficiency, uptime enhancement, performance increment, and productivity improvement are some of the benefits that turn the IT industry towards AIOps. Simultaneously, AI solutions are growing rapidly, and adaptation has accelerated. 
Automated Remediation: 
As far as AI is concerned, 2024 belongs to AI-powered remedies for IT infrastructure. The role of AI and automation solutions isn’t limited to merely detecting and tracking. AIOps solutions now efficiently solve issues and incidents through automation to ensure there is less downtime, peak performance, and recovery time. 
Faster Response Times
Compared to humans, AI is way too fast at investigating incidents and resolving them.
Lesser Errors
The manual resolution has a risk of repetition attached to it, besides human errors. The predefined workflow through automation leaves no scope for errors to reoccur.
Increased Efficiency
Once AIOps solutions take over, the IT team can focus on more productive and knowledge-based tasks.
24/7 Coverage
Humans need rest; electromechanical systems do not demand rest. AIOps are capable of providing 24*7 remedial services to fix errors that may thwart operations.
Auditability
It was difficult to record human movements that fixed problems, whereas AI solutions are efficient enough to provide a complete trail of events for training purposes.
Intelligent remediation is on the rise, and 2024 will witness the acceleration of automated risk aversion using AIOps solutions. All that IT companies need is human monitoring instead of operational interventions.

Code Generation
According to recent data, 68% of ChatGPT users are believed to be developers who use the platform for code generation purposes. AIOps help developers write new codes and fix ones with flaws automatically.
Synthetic Test Data Generation
Generative models can generate synthetic test data that is statistically representative by learning from real production data. This provides ample testing data without privacy concerns.
Predictive Forecasting
Generative models can accurately predict future infrastructure and traffic patterns. Utilizing these forecasts, AIOps can proactively allocate resources.

Adaptive Observability:
As the name suggests, AIOps underlines the observation capabilities of AIOps solutions in monitoring the IT environment and adjusting to needs. The technology puts logs, trails, sequences, and metrics in a mix to deliver comprehensive insights into IT operations in real-time, enabling businesses to respond to changing situations quickly and adequately.
Explainable AI (XAI):
The explainable AI technique allows businesses to build trust and transparency through insightful decision-making. AI engineers develop AIOps models that clearly distinguish between reasons to explain the bases of decision-making for efficient resolution of recurring issues.
Automated Root Cause Analysis (ARCA):
In 2024, AIOps and MLOps will enhance their capabilities to identify the root causes of problems in complex IT environments. AI and automation solutions don’t limit themselves to identifying solutions but to quickly respond to disruptive incidents to ensure speedy recovery, reduce downtime, improve peak performance, and enhance system reliability.
Predictive Analytics Maturity:
Artificial intelligence is rapidly developing its predictive analysis capabilities to enable AIOps solutions to forecast customer behavior, market dynamics, and resource demands with accuracy. This analytical data helps businesses scale resources, optimize infrastructure, and have flawless operations.
AI-Enhanced Security Operations:
Cyber threats are the most prominent worry that IT companies are facing, and AIOps will change how companies protect their data, applications, and other resources. Machine learning algorithms detect and eliminate threats, enhancing IT infrastructure to be more threat-resilient.
